linux学习
Linux操作系统是一种开源的操作系统,具有自由使用、开放源代码以及高度的可定制性等特点。随着云计算和大数据时代的到来,Linux操作系统在各个领域中得到了广泛的应用。学习Linux操作系统成为了许多IT从业人员必备的技能之一。
学习Linux操作系统可以帮助我们更好地理解计算机的工作原理。相比于其他操作系统,Linux操作系统更加透明且具备更高的可见性。学习Linux可以帮助我们深入了解计算机的内核和各个组件之间的关系,从而更好地理解计算机系统是如何工作的。
学习Linux操作系统可以为我们提供更多的职业发展机会。随着云计算和大数据技术的迅速发展,越来越多的企业开始采用Linux操作系统来构建和管理他们的系统。具备Linux操作系统的技能可以使我们在职场中脱颖而出,为我们的职业生涯打下坚实的基础。
学习Linux操作系统还可以使我们成为更好的程序员。Linux操作系统提供了丰富的开发工具和环境,可以帮助我们更加高效地进行软件开发。通过学习Linux,我们可以学习到如何使用命令行工具进行程序编译、调试和运行,了解到如何使用脚本语言来自动化任务等。这些技能对于提高程序员的工作效率和编写高质量的代码非常有帮助。
学习Linux操作系统还可以培养我们的解决问题的能力。在学习过程中,我们会遇到各种各样的问题,例如如何配置网络、如何安装软件等。解决这些问题需要我们进行独立思考,查找相关的文档和资源并尝试不同的解决方案。通过这个过程,我们可以逐渐培养起解决问题的能力,这对于我们未来的职业发展非常有帮助。
linux学习路线图
随着信息技术的不断发展和应用,Linux操作系统逐渐成为IT行业中的主流选择。作为一款开源的操作系统,Linux具有高度可定制化、稳定性强、安全性高等优势,备受企业和个人用户的青睐。要深入学习和掌握Linux操作系统并不是一件容易的事情,需要有一条系统的学习路线图。
学习Linux的基础知识是不可或缺的。这包括Linux的历史背景、基本概念、文件系统、用户管理、文件权限等基础知识。这些基础知识的掌握能够为后续学习打下坚实的基础。
熟悉Linux系统的常用命令是必要的。Linux操作系统是基于命令行的操作系统,掌握常用命令是非常重要的。文件和目录的操作、系统信息的查询、进程管理等。学习命令行的使用可以提高操作效率,也为后续系统管理和开发工作做好准备。
进一步,学习Linux的系统管理技术是非常重要的。系统管理涉及到对系统的配置、安装、维护和监控等方面。其中包括磁盘管理、网络管理、用户管理、安全设置等。系统管理的能力对于运维人员来说至关重要,能够提高系统的稳定性和安全性。
对于开发者来说,学习Linux的开发技术也是很有必要的。Linux提供了丰富的开发环境和工具,可以支持各种编程语言和开发框架。学习Linux开发技术可以帮助开发者更好地利用操作系统的功能,提高开发效率和代码质量。
学习Linux的网络和安全技术也是很重要的。网络技术涉及到网络配置、网络服务的设置和管理等方面,对于网络管理人员和安全人员来说是必备的技能。安全技术则包括对系统的安全硬化、漏洞分析、入侵检测等方面的知识,能够提高系统的安全性。